The Venue
Small but perfectly formed, the Little Banqueting House is ideal for intimate riverside wedding ceremonies, receptions or dinners. Perfect for host wedding ceremonies and receptions for up to 50 guests.
This hidden gem offers stunning views over the River Thames, as well as the Tudor and Baroque architecture of Hampton Court Palace. Hire starts from just £5,000 plus VAT.
The highlight of the sumptuous interior is undoubtedly the spectacular paintings and ceiling murals by Antonio Verrio, which date to the 18th century.
You and your guests will also enjoy exclusive use of our private walled garden, which is perfect for drinks receptions or after dinner dancing.

A setting rich in history
The River Thames has been the palace’s lifeline for over 500 years, serving as both a transport route and a source of inspiration for monarchs and courtiers. Today, it continues to provide a remarkable backdrop for weddings that combine natural beauty with royal heritage, offering a celebration in the very heart of England’s history.
